Challenge
The brand had to speak to two audiences at once — kids who dream of turning pro and the families who decide — without falling into childish cliché or the corporate solemnity of classic academies.
Strategy
Football training like never before.
The positioning rests on three ideas: performance (serious, measurable methodology), technology (data and tools serving the player) and belonging (team, league, community). For a twelve-year-old, the aspirational language isn't the academy's: it's the sports videogame's — player cards, stats, overall, match days. BE EVO adopts that code and fills it with real training content.
For families, the same identity demonstrates method: every graphic piece organises information — levels, groups, calendars, standings — with the visual discipline of a professional sports organisation. The brand promises evolution and shows it: from the first training session to GRAND FINALS.

Identity
The logotype is modularly constructed: BE and EVO articulate over a bar that fixes proportions, clear space — always equal to the bar's height — and letter spacing. The construction is put through a reduction test to guarantee the forms hold from pitch-side banner to favicon, and the rules explicitly forbid altering the internal spacing: those proportions are part of the mark's drawing.
The identity is also born with a technology partner inside: TARS. The partnership rules fix how both logotypes live together — hierarchy, separation, versions — to ensure a coherent, recognisable presence in any shared context.

System
Colour is the brand's operating system: eight ramps — neutrals, aqua, purple, fire red, electric blue, orange, green and lime — with their steps documented in HEX. The breadth is deliberate: an ecosystem with seventeen teams, three competitions and progression levels needs more than a corporate colour; it needs a palette that can encode without repeating itself.
Two families share the voice. Le Murmure, the brand typeface, brings the emotional, expressive layer: it represents each player's individual growth and the capacity to break limits. Science Gothic, the secondary, is a variable typeface designed to be global, versatile and distinctive on screen: it carries data, labels and everything that must read fast. The icon set follows in two styles — line and full — for interface and signage.

Applications
The identity was tested where it will live: player cards with stats — Sho, Def, Pas, Dri — and overall, match-day posters (DAY 01, SEMIFINALS, GRAND FINALS), BE EVO LEAGUE standings tables with their teams, kits and the Instagram feed. The gaming code isn't decoration: it's the interface through which a player watches their own evolution.
The three competitions — BE EVO CHALLENGE, BE EVO LEAGUE and EVO CHAMPION CUP — share the system but are distinguished by colour and composition, so the season's full calendar communicates without stepping outside the brand rules.

The outcome is an identity system ready for opening day: mark construction and usage, cohabitation rules with technology partner TARS, eight documented colour ramps, two type families with defined roles, a two-style icon set and the full competitive ecosystem — BE EVO CHALLENGE, BE EVO LEAGUE and EVO CHAMPION CUP — designed from the player card to match day.
